My "Check Fuel Cap" keeps blinking. I checked the cap and have filled the
tank twice sense. Still comes on. Has any one hade this problem. I like to
know the problem before calling the dealer so I don't get the runaround.

Has the gas cap ever been dropped?
The internal vent goes bad and will not hold pressure. Common problem,
especially if the cap falls on the ground.
If your car is under warranty, the cap will be replaced for free.

It is tied into the OBDII codes but the last couple years if the code is
generated Honda's turn the check fuel cap message on the dash. Saves on some
service calls. >> Stay informed about: Check Fuel Cap |
